1. A very rare 1962/63 Rex Monaco. Only 250 were made and imported to the USA through Califonia. This one comes with the original tool kit and has the original rubber floor boards in tact! 339 origial miles on the CEV speedometer. Both, front and rear lenses are in great shape. All original paint.

6. Valmobile: a 1962/63 Suitcase Scooter that was designed to fold up and go into the back of a car or airplane. Made in japan. Comes with one original Toyo tire (front) and a rare battery box. Comes with a copy of the original manual and some advisements. I have nos tail lights, upgraded the front light to LED, and installed a new ignition switch. The stator was sent out and had new points, condsensor put in, the ignition coil was redone, and tested. New rubber suspension for the rear. Lots of work done just needs a little more time to finish the project.
